boolean ensureStartClockTime(final long currentTime) {
final long ABOUT_ONE_YEAR = 365*24*60*60*1000L;
if (currentTime > ABOUT_ONE_YEAR && mStartClockTime < (currentTime-ABOUT_ONE_YEAR)) {
// If the start clock time has changed by more than a year, then presumably
// the previous time was completely bogus. So we are going to figure out a
// new time based on how much time has elapsed since we started counting.
mStartClockTime = currentTime - (SystemClock.elapsedRealtime()-(mRealtimeStart/1000));
return true;
}
return false;
}
